Capacity note: Shelfwright catalogue import. The nightly MARC dump from the Bramleigh branch now tops 400k records, and the parser chews memory if we batch too aggressively. Keep the worker pool small; the bottleneck is the dedupe index, not CPU. If you bump batch size, watch heap during the first hour. The constants below are what survived three rounds of trial and error.

tuning constants:
QUOTAS = {
    "druwyn": 5,
    "holix": 5,
    "zorath": 5,
    "holwyn": 10,
}

# Break-Glass: Catalog Cache Invalidation

Scope: the Pinrow product catalog at Veldstone Retail. If stale prices persist after a purge and the Hollowmere invalidation queue is wedged, use break-glass to flush the edge tier directly. Contractors: get verbal sign-off from the catalog lead first. Steps: open the Hollowmere admin shell, select emergency-flush, confirm the tenant, and run it once — repeated flushes thrash the origin. Access is logged and expires after 20 minutes. Unseal the admin shell with the passphrase below.

recovery phrase for kahop-tajog: istix-casvan

Subject: Quickstore 4.2 — bloom filter now fronts the KV layer

Plugin authors: starting with this release, Quickstore places a bloom filter ahead of the key-value store. Negative lookups return faster; false positives fall through safely. No API changes are required on your side. Verify your plugin against the staging build referenced below.

session token of fahif-tadup = htk3_9c7

Q: Where are the search relevance tuning notes kept? A: All tuning experiments for the Lanternfish ranker live in the relevance wiki, organized by quarter. Each note records the boost weights tried, the evaluation set used, and the sign-off reviewer. The wiki space is sealed; new team members must unseal it once using the team recovery passphrase, which appears below.

recovery phrase for fajep-yaweg: gilath-sorox-wenius-rusdor-keliel-zorius

Thumbnail generation queue (Pixbatch) stopped processing plugin uploads last night. Root cause: the shared worker credential expired and jobs now fail with a 401 at enqueue time. Retries won't help until you swap credentials. Clear your local cache, update your plugin config, and resubmit stuck jobs. Use the replacement key for the internal queue service below.

API key for tajog-bajof: kto15_6fvgvYZbOKdLifh